Dinner: Bacon-wrapped Shrimp with Basil-Garlic Stuffing

Recipe by Jan Robinson The name says it all. What's better than bacon? Shrimp wrapped in bacon and stuffed with Parmesan cheese, basil, and garlic. Serve these delectable appetizers in soup spoons for over-the-top presentation.

Ingredients

1 pound large shrimp
1/3 cup chopped fresh basil
1 1/2 tablespoons freshly grated Parmesan cheese
2 garlic cloves, minced
16 pieces thinly sliced bacon
1/2 cup prepared fruit-based barbecue sauce

Instructions

Peel and devein shrimp, leaving tails on. Butterfly shrimp by cutting a slit along the back and gently pressing open.
Combine basil, Parmesan, and garlic in a small bowl. Place basil mixture evenly in shrimp openings; press shrimp closed.
Cook bacon over medium heat until partially cooked. Drain on paper towels.
Wrap each shrimp with 1 slice bacon, and place on greased baking sheet. Brush barbecue sauce over shrimp, and bake at 400 ° for 8 to 9 minutes.
